Bottom-up Processing
An approach in perception where processing starts with sensory input and builds up towards the final conceptual representation.
Sensory Adaptation
The process by which sensory receptors become less sensitive to constant or unchanging stimuli.
Stimulus Energies
The physical or environmental energies that an organism can detect and respond to, such as light, sound, and temperature.
Sensory Receptors
Specialized cells or nerve endings that respond to changes in the environment and transmit signals to the nervous system.
